What are the 7 stages of procurement?

Here are the 7 steps involved in the procurement process:

  • Step 0: Recognition required.
  • Step 1: Purchase requisition.
  • Step 2: Apply for review.
  • Step 3: Solicitation Process.
  • Step 4: Evaluation and Contract.
  • Step 5: Order management.
  • Step 6: Invoice Approval and Dispute.
  • Step 7: Record keeping.

What does procure-to-pay mean?

Procure to Pay is The process of integrating purchasing and accounts payable systems to increase efficiency. It exists within the larger procurement management process and involves four key stages: selection of goods and services; enforcement of compliance and order; receipt and reconciliation; invoicing and payment.

What is self-purchase?

self-purchased, or independent procurement, Insurance means any policy purchased from an insurance company that has never been licensed in the insured’s state. The practice is legal but discouraged because the state will not be able to provide protection if the insurance provider goes bankrupt.

What is an example of procurement?

Direct sourcing involves any activity undertaken to obtain materials required for a finished product. …for example, directly sourcing a company that produces cookies would include Items such as flour, eggs, and butter.

What are the purchasing methods?

6 Procurement Methods: Access to Quality Goods and Services

  • purchasing method. Generally speaking, there are six procurement methods used by a company’s procurement team. …
  • Open tender. …
  • Restricted Bidding. …
  • Request for Proposal (RFP)…
  • Two-stage bidding. …
  • Inquiry. …
  • single source.
